In the world of robotics and automation, various components play crucial roles in ensuring that machines operate smoothly and efficiently. One such component is the actuating arm, which is essential for performing precise movements and tasks. The actuating arm is a mechanical device that translates rotational motion into linear motion, allowing it to interact with other parts of a system or carry out specific functions. Understanding how the actuating arm works can provide insights into the design and functionality of robotic systems.The actuating arm is often powered by motors, which can be electric, hydraulic, or pneumatic. These motors drive the arm's movement, enabling it to reach and manipulate objects in its environment. For instance, in industrial settings, an actuating arm might be used in assembly lines to pick up items, assemble components, or package products. The precision of the actuating arm allows for high levels of accuracy, reducing the chances of errors during production processes.One of the key features of the actuating arm is its ability to be controlled programmatically. This means that operators can set specific parameters for the arm's movements, allowing for repetitive tasks to be performed with minimal human intervention. The integration of sensors with the actuating arm also enhances its functionality. Sensors can provide feedback about the arm's position and the objects it interacts with, allowing for adjustments to be made in real-time. This feedback loop is critical in applications where precision is paramount, such as in medical robotics or delicate assembly tasks.Moreover, the design of the actuating arm can vary significantly depending on its intended use. Some arms are designed to mimic human movements closely, while others may have a more rigid structure suited for specific tasks. For example, a robotic arm used in surgery may need to have a high degree of flexibility and dexterity, whereas an actuating arm used in a factory setting might prioritize strength and stability.As technology continues to advance, the capabilities of actuating arms are expanding. Innovations in materials science are leading to lighter and stronger arms, while advancements in artificial intelligence are allowing for more sophisticated control systems. These developments open up new possibilities for automation across various industries, from manufacturing to healthcare.In conclusion, the actuating arm is a vital component in the realm of robotics and automation. Its ability to perform precise movements and tasks makes it indispensable in many applications. As technology evolves, we can expect the actuating arm to become even more advanced, further en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of automated systems. Understanding the mechanics and functionality of the actuating arm not only highlights its importance but also underscores the ongoing evolution of robotic technology in our modern world.
